Laboratory Testing and Identification
The American Institute of Diamond Cutting is equipped to offer professional opinions based on laboratory testing and experienced observations on the following subjects:
- Rough diamonds that may or may not be natural
- Rough diamonds that may have been treated to imitate fancy colors
- Finished diamonds that are natural or synthetic
- Color bands that can be utilized to create fancy colors
- Cutting and polishing procedures to enhance face up color
- Reducing face up yellow colors by re-proportioning the finished diamond
- Color concentrations in both rough and finished

Flourescence in rough diamonds

Identifying fancy colored diamonds
